APPLICATION FOR LANDLORD CONSENT TO LOCALLY-FINANCED AND/OR LOCALLY-MANAGED IMPROVEMENTS OR ALTERATION WORK – COMMUNITY AND VOLUNTARY CONTROLLED SCHOOLS AND ACADEMIES (WHERE APPLICABLE)

The Landlord Consent form is required to ensure that the Local Authority has a strategic overview of building work being carried out at schools and academies where the Local Authority is the Landlord. Approval to this form does not constitute technical approval to a scheme, as it is for individual schools to ensure that all necessary consents are obtained and that the work proposed complies fully with the appropriate regulations and statutory requirements. Any changes that might affect a school’s capacity should be specifically noted and also agreed with the school’s Planning and Admissions Adviser prior to the submission of the approval form. Such changes would include the provision of new teaching accommodation and/or the conversion of teaching accommodation to non-teaching or vice-versa.
